Challenging Convention, brilliantly curated by the Laing’s keeper of art Lizzie Jacklin, features 60 works of Vanessa Bell (1879-1961), Laura Knight (1877-1970), Gwen John (1876-1939) and Dod Procter (1890-1972), drawn from up to 30 lenders. The artists were contemporaries, living in times of enormous changes and the exhibition highlights the strides they made in a male-dominated field. Gwen John, sister of the celebrated painter Augustus John, found fame while living and working in Paris. She preferred solitude and avoided “family conventions and ties”, yet forged intense friendships and had love affairs with fellow artists, including the sculptor August Rodin, for whom she modelled.
West Offices, City of York Council headquarters THE council made a U-turn on a decision to ban the public from attending a public meeting – 11 minutes before it was due to start. Residents raised concerns after the agenda for City of York Council’s annual council meeting said it would not be open to members of the public to attend in person but would be broadcast live on Youtube. Since May 7 council meetings must be held in public. Local authorities have sought larger venues to accommodate more people under social distancing guidelines – with Calderdale Council holding its annual council meeting at Halifax Minster with all 51 councillors and guests, and more than 70 people at a Cambridgeshire County Council meeting hosted by the Imperial War Museum in Duxford.

1. Jazz on a Summer Evening at RHS Hyde Hall
June 26
The Rotary Club of Wickford has hosted this musical event for 32 years to help raise vital funds for St Luke’s Hospice in Basildon. As part of RHS Hyde Hall, Hyde Hall Live (June 25-27) celebrates opening up after lockdown. Enjoy the Sunshine Kings Jazz band in the open-air environment with your picnic. From 6.15pm.The Hyde Hall Live line up also includes The Bluejays on Friday June 25 and Lord Toffingham on Sunday June 27.
